What is the best titanium alloy for aerospace?
After 2,000+ aerospace titanium orders, our engineers swear by:
1. Grade 5 (6Al-4V)
Pros: Best all-rounder
Cons: More difficult to machine
2. Grade 23 (6Al-4V ELI)
Pros: Enhanced fracture toughness
Cons: 20% cost premium
3. Grade 9 (3Al-2.5V)
Pros: Superior cold formability
Cons: Lower high-temp strength
